Chaos Erupts in Salem! Marlena’s Health in Jeopardy and Blackout Shakes the Town

Thumbnail

Days of our Lives spoilers for the week of September 22-26, 2025 tease a health scare and a city-wide crisis.

While it’s unknown what causes it, spoilers tease a blackout will strike Salem by the end of the week. Salem is due for a city-wide tragedy, like the underground explosion of 2012 that “killed” Jack (Matthew Ashford) or, most memorably, the time the Salem Stalker murdered the entire cast just for them to appear alive and well on an island.

Whatever this blackout has in store, it’s going to leave Alex (Robert Scott Wilson) to help Chanel (Raven Bowens) and Felicity (Kennedy Garcia) at the bakery, while Philip (John-Paul Lavoisier), Brady (Eric Martsolf), and Gabi (Cherie Jimenez) will find themselves trapped.

Marlena’s Health

Meanwhile, worries about Marlena’s (Deidre Hall) health will resurface after she passes out on Thursday. This wouldn’t be the first time she’s passed out, and these fainting spells are presumably linked to her dreams about Stefano (the late Joe Mascolo). At the start of the week, she’ll receive troubling news that could also be related to her health

Odds and Ends

On the adoption front, Chanel and Johnny (Carson Boatman) will remain optimistic about their chances of adopting Baby Tesoro. It’s hard to tell which couple an adoption agency would side with — Johnny and Chanel or Leo (Greg Rikaart) and Javi (Al Calderon) — but when Sophia (Rachel Boyd) is said to plot against Johnny and Chanel on Thursday, it seems her vote isn’t for them to adopt her baby boy.

As for the Kiriakis clan, Alex, Brady, Philip, and Xander (Paul Telfer) will all butt heads mid-week over how to save their family company. Tony (Thaao Penghlis) is after everything they’ve got, and with Brady considering stepping away from the company, they may be down a Kiriakis in this fight.
